#include <object_pool.h>
◆ no_lock_object_pool() [1/2]
template<typename T, typename TInitializer = default_initializer<T>, typename TCleanup = default_cleanup<T>>
◆ no_lock_object_pool() [2/2]
template<typename T, typename TInitializer = default_initializer<T>, typename TCleanup = default_cleanup<T>>
◆ ~no_lock_object_pool()
template<typename T, typename TInitializer = default_initializer<T>, typename TCleanup = default_cleanup<T>>
◆ empty()
template<typename T, typename TInitializer = default_initializer<T>, typename TCleanup = default_cleanup<T>>
◆ get_object()
template<typename T, typename TInitializer = default_initializer<T>, typename TCleanup = default_cleanup<T>>
◆ is_from_pool()
template<typename T, typename TInitializer = default_initializer<T>, typename TCleanup = default_cleanup<T>>
◆ return_object()
template<typename T, typename TInitializer = default_initializer<T>, typename TCleanup = default_cleanup<T>>
◆ size()
template<typename T, typename TInitializer = default_initializer<T>, typename TCleanup = default_cleanup<T>>
The documentation for this struct was generated from the following file: